      I was 13 years old.  My family had moved to Southern California from North Florida a year before. 

 I hit adolescence with a vengeance.  I was angry and rebellious, with little regard for anything my parents

had to say, particularly if it had to do with me.  Like so many teenagers, I struggled to escape from

anything that didn't agree with my picture of the world. A "brilliant without need of guidance" kid, I

rejected any overt offering of love.  In fact, I got angry at the mention of the word love.

     One night, after a particularly difficult day, I _____________, shut the door and got into bed.  As I

lay down in the privacy of my bed, my hands slipped under my pillow.  There was an envelope.  I pulled

it out and on the envelope it said, "To read when you're alone."

     Since I was alone, no one would know whether I read it or not, so I opened it.  It said "Mike, I know

life is hard right now, I know you are frustrated and I know we don't do everything right.  I also know

that I love you completely and nothing you do or say will ever change that.  I am here for you if you ever

need to talk, and if you don't, that's okay.  Just know that no matter where you go or what you do in your

life, I will always love you and be proud that you are my son.  I'm here for you and I love you - that will

never change.  Love, Mom.

That was the first of several "To read when you're alone" letters.  They were never mentioned until I was

an adult.

Today I travel the world helping people.  I was in Sarasota, Florida, teaching a seminar when, at the end

of the day, a lady came up to me and shared the difficulty she was having with her son.  We walked out

to the beach, and I told her of my mom's undying love and about the "To read when you're alone" letters.  Several weeks later, I got a card that said she had written her first letter and left it for her son.

     That night as I went to bed, I put my hands under my pillow and remembered the relief I felt every

time I got a letter.  In the midst of my turbulent teen years, the letters were the calm assurance that I

could be loved in spite of me, not because of me.  Just before I fell asleep I thanked God that my mom

knew what I, an angry teenager, needed.  Today when the seas of life get stormy, I know that just under

my pillow there is that calm assurance that love - consistent, abiding, unconditional love - changes lives.
